Qual é a representação interna de inf e NaN?

Um amigo e eu estávamos debatendo sobre como Inf e NaN são armazenados durante o almoço hoj

Tome Fortran 90, por exemplo. Reais de 4 bytes podem obter o valor de Inf ou NaN. Como isso é armazenado internamente? Presumivelmente, um real de 4 bytes é um número representado internamente por um número binário de 32 dígitos. Os Inf e NaN são armazenados como números binários de 33 bits?

questionAnswers(2)

yourAnswerToTheQuestion